{ "schema_version": "1.4.0", "id": "GHSA-jgqr-hf4v-qm4q", "modified": "2025-04-20T03:48:04Z", "published": "2022-05-17T00:20:22Z", "aliases": [ "CVE-2017-16524" ], "details": "Web Viewer 1.0.0.193 on Samsung SRN-1670D devices suffers from an Unrestricted file upload vulnerability: 'network_ssl_upload.php' allows remote authenticated attackers to upload and execute arbitrary PHP code via a filename with a .php extension, which is then accessed via a direct request to the file in the upload/ directory. To authenticate for this attack, one can obtain web-interface credentials in cleartext by leveraging the existing Local File Read Vulnerability referenced as CVE-2015-8279, which allows remote attackers to read the web-interface credentials via a request for the cslog_export.php?path=/root/php_modules/lighttpd/sbin/userpw URI.", "severity": [ { "type": "CVSS_V3", "score": "C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H" } ], "affected": [], "references": [ { "type": "ADVISORY", "url": "https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2017-16524" }, { "type": "WEB", "url": "https://github.com/realistic-security/CVE-2017-16524" }, { "type": "WEB", "url": "https://www.exploit-db.com/exploits/43138" } ], "database_specific": { "cwe_ids": [ "CWE-434" ], "severity": "HIGH", "github_reviewed": false, "github_reviewed_at": null, "nvd_published_at": "2017-11-06T08:29:00Z" } }
